Hi and welcome.

Is this a wooden or aluminum framed windshield?

Hardware such as cleats and chocks and lights were pretty generic. Thompson used pasrts from many suppliers such as Perko, Kainer, Wilcox-Crittenden, etc... I know they used Kainer and Attwood parts on some of the boats in 1965.

Watch ebay auctions etc... to try and find stuff.

I restored last year a 1965 Thompson Bros. Sea Lancer 18 footer. She had a M-6250 Attwood bow light and was supposed to have a Kainer 6006 stern light. T-8 Kainer cleats were common for the 1965 models along with T-6 chocks.
